# Analytics Module The Analytics module provides a star-schema data warehouse layer for SBOM and attestation data, enabling executive reporting, risk dashboards, and ad-hoc analysis. ## Overview Stella Ops generates rich data through SBOM ingestion, vulnerability correlation, VEX assessments, and attestations. The Analytics module normalizes this data into a queryable warehouse schema optimized for: - **Executive dashboards**: Risk posture, vulnerability trends, compliance status - **Supply chain analysis**: Supplier concentration, license distribution - **Security metrics**: CVE exposure, VEX effectiveness, MTTR tracking - **Attestation coverage**: SLSA compliance, provenance gaps ## Key Capabilities | Capability | Description | |------------|-------------| | Unified component registry | Canonical component table with normalized suppliers and licenses | | Vulnerability correlation | Pre-joined component-vulnerability mapping with EPSS/KEV flags | | VEX-adjusted exposure | Vulnerability counts that respect VEX overrides | | Attestation tracking | Provenance and SLSA level coverage by environment/team | | Time-series rollups | Daily snapshots for trend analysis | | Materialized views | Pre-computed aggregations for dashboard performance | ## Data Model ### Star Schema Overview ``` ┌─────────────────┐ │ artifacts │ (dimension) │ container/app │ └────────┬────────┘ │ ┌──────────────┼──────────────┐ │ │ │ ┌─────────▼──────┐ ┌─────▼─────┐ ┌──────▼──────┐ │ artifact_ │ │attestations│ │vex_overrides│ │ components │ │ (fact) │ │ (fact) │ │ (bridge) │ └───────────┘ └─────────────┘ └─────────┬──────┘ │ ┌─────────▼──────┐ │ components │ (dimension) │ unified │ │ registry │ └─────────┬──────┘ │ ┌─────────▼──────┐ │ component_ │ │ vulns │ (fact) │ (bridge) │ └────────────────┘ ``` ### Core Tables | Table | Type | Purpose | |-------|------|---------| | `components` | Dimension | Unified component registry with PURL, supplier, license | | `artifacts` | Dimension | Container images and applications with SBOM metadata | | `artifact_components` | Bridge | Links artifacts to their SBOM components | | `component_vulns` | Fact | Component-to-vulnerability mapping | | `attestations` | Fact | Attestation metadata (provenance, SBOM, VEX) | | `vex_overrides` | Fact | VEX status overrides with justifications | | `raw_sboms` | Audit | Raw SBOM payloads for reprocessing | | `raw_attestations` | Audit | Raw DSSE envelopes for audit | | `daily_vulnerability_counts` | Rollup | Daily vuln aggregations | | `daily_component_counts` | Rollup | Daily component aggregations | ### Materialized Views | View | Refresh | Purpose | |------|---------|---------| | `mv_supplier_concentration` | Daily | Top suppliers by component count | | `mv_license_distribution` | Daily | License category distribution | | `mv_vuln_exposure` | Daily | CVE exposure adjusted by VEX | | `mv_attestation_coverage` | Daily | Provenance/SLSA coverage by env/team | ## Quick Start ### Day-1 Queries **Top supplier concentration (supply chain risk):** ```sql SELECT * FROM analytics.sp_top_suppliers(20); ``` **License risk heatmap:** ```sql SELECT * FROM analytics.sp_license_heatmap(); ``` **CVE exposure adjusted by VEX:** ```sql SELECT * FROM analytics.sp_vuln_exposure('prod', 'high'); ``` **Fixable vulnerability backlog:** ```sql SELECT * FROM analytics.sp_fixable_backlog('prod'); ``` **Attestation coverage gaps:** ```sql SELECT * FROM analytics.sp_attestation_gaps('prod'); ``` ### API Endpoints | Endpoint | Method | Description | |----------|--------|-------------| | `/api/analytics/suppliers` | GET | Supplier concentration data | | `/api/analytics/licenses` | GET | License distribution | | `/api/analytics/vulnerabilities` | GET | CVE exposure (VEX-adjusted) | | `/api/analytics/backlog` | GET | Fixable vulnerability backlog | | `/api/analytics/attestation-coverage` | GET | Attestation gaps | | `/api/analytics/trends/vulnerabilities` | GET | Vulnerability time-series | | `/api/analytics/trends/components` | GET | Component time-series | ## Architecture See [architecture.md](./architecture.md) for detailed design decisions, data flow, and normalization rules. ## Schema Reference See [analytics_schema.sql](../../db/analytics_schema.sql) for complete DDL including: - Table definitions with indexes - Normalization functions - Materialized views - Stored procedures - Refresh procedures ## Sprint Reference Implementation tracked in: `docs/implplan/SPRINT_20260120_030_Platform_sbom_analytics_lake.md`
